How much compensation to be paid for international parcels booked in India?
Response: The compensation to be paid in respect of International Parcels booked in Post Offices in India in case of loss / total theft / total damage are as under: For loss / total theft / total damage – 40 SDR* per parcel and 4.50 SDR* per kg.
What services does India Post provide?
In reply to that: International Letters India Post provides basic international postal services viz. Letters, Post Cards, Aerogramme, Small Packets, Blind Literature, Printed Papers, M Bag (Special bags containing newspapers, periodicals, books and similar printed documentation for the same addressee at same address)
